The little Red Hen was in the farmyard with her chickens, when she found a grain of wheat.

``Who will plant this wheat?'' she said.

``Not I,'' said the Goose.

``Not I,'' said the Duck.

``I will, then,'' said the little Red Hen, and she planted the grain of wheat.

When the wheat was ripe she said, ``Who will take this wheat to the mill?''

``Not I,'' said the Goose.

``Not I,'' said the Duck.

``I will, then,'' said the little Red Hen, and she took the wheat to the mill.

When she brought the flour home she said, ``Who will make some bread with this flour?''

``Not I,'' said the Goose.

``Not I,'' said the Duck.

``I will, then,'' said the little Red Hen

When the bread was baked, she said, ``Who will eat this bread?''

``I will,'' said the Goose

``I will,'' said the Duck

``No, you won't,'' said the little Red Hen. ``I shall eat it myself. Cluck! cluck!'' And she called her chickens to help her.
